RPM packages fail to install when FIPS Enabled

Description

During a customer installation we observed the following behavior when starting the initial installation of the Meridian 2022.1.5 packages: 

 

We found that this error came up because FIPS was enabled in the customer environment. We were able to use the following command to see if FIPS was enabled:

 

 

We were able to use the following command to disable FIPS: 

 

After disabling FIPS, we were able to download and instal the JICMP/JICMP6 packages without any issues. We were also able to bypass the issue by downloading the JICMP/JICMP6 packages locally and installing them with the following command:
